Woods Hole Coastal and Marine Science Center Data Library
The Data Library maintains the data produced by research at the U.S. Geological Survey Woods Hole Coastal and Marine Science Center (WHCMSC) and provides access to a wide variety of digital data through online portals. In addition, visitors to the library can examine the original analog data in person and request copies for use in their own research projects.

Re-Evaluating the Causes and Hazards of South Carolina Earthquakes
Unlike many other parts of the world where earthquakes occur along boundaries between tectonic plates, South Carolina earthquakes result from the reactivation of ancient geologic structures associated with much older tectonic events such as the building of the Appalachian Mountains and the rifting that opened the Atlantic Ocean.
New Quaternary Geology Map Reuses Decades-Old USGS Data
For the past several years, the USGS Eastern Geology and Paleoclimate Science Center has been working to produce a new Quaternary geologic map for Massachusetts and adjacent offshore areas based on new understandings of glacier dynamics and now-submerged glacial lake deposits.
